Lars Lindström is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Ecology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Lars Lindström has authored 47 papers receiving a total of 2.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 8 papers in Ecology and 6 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Lars Lindström’s work include Muscle activation and electromyography studies (16 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(5 papers) and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(5 papers). Lars Lindström is often cited by papers focused on Muscle activation and electromyography studies (16 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(5 papers) and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(5 papers). Lars Lindström collaborates with scholars based in Sweden, Canada and Tanzania. Lars Lindström's co-authors include Robert Magnusson, Ingemar Petersén, Jennifer Beck, Roland Kadefors, Christer A. Sinderby, Maricela de la Torre‐Castro, Sven Friberg, Narriman Jiddawi, A. Grassino and Paolo Navalesi and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Medicine, The Journal of Physiology and Proceedings of the IEEE.
